As part of my MBA program, we are suppose to dress business casual for class (although it doesn't always happen), and lets be real, it can be so boring being stuck having to wear those types of clothes. To spice up my 'business casual' look, I always like to add some fun pants, colourful shirt, red/pink lipstick, or fun accessories such as large statement necklaces. Or I also love going back to basics and put on a slim-fitting dress. It's business attire and it makes me feel oh so lovely!
